Words of the Day: Pandemonium: [pan-duh-moh-nee-uh m] Noun 1. Wild uproar or unrestrained disorder; tumult or chaos. 2. A place or scene of riotous uproar or utter chaos. 3. (often initial capital letter) the abode of all the demons. 4. hell Delirium [dih-leer-ee-uh m] Noun 1. Pathology. a more or less temporary disorder of the mental facilities, as in fevers, disturbances of consciousness, or intixication, characterized by restlessness, excitement, delusions, hallucinations, etc. 2. a state of violent excitement or emotion.
